What happened
Landlord applied for an order to terminate the tenancy and evict Tenant due to failure to pay rent. The application was filed after serving a valid Notice to End Tenancy Early for Non-payment of Rent (N4 Notice), which the tenant did not void by paying the arrears.
The ruling
The tenancy is terminated effective March 23, 2021. The Tenant must pay the Landlord $16,521.98, which includes rent arrears up to March 12, 2021 and the application filing fee, less the rent deposit and interest on the deposit. The Tenant must also pay $76.37 per day for compensation for use of the unit starting March 13, 2021 until the Tenant vacates. If the Tenant pays the full amount of $20,843.00 on or before March 23, 2021, the eviction order will be void and the Tenant can remain in the unit.
